Stopped in to New Corral after leaving the city from a Broadway show and remembering there was one more "all the way dog" spot I wanted to hit in Clifton. Went to Rutt's and Hot Grill a couple years back and have been meaning to come here for a while. Cool little old diner style place and the woman who was our server was friendly and attentive. Tried out the All the Way dogs and some fries and my son got a grilled cheese. He said he really enjoyed the grilled cheese and he ate most of the fries himself haha. The dogs were solid, I'd put them right on par with the other spots locally honestly. I'm sure I'll get my head taken off by the "rippers from Rutt's are the best things ever" crowd, but the thing that makes the ripper for me is the yellow cabbage relish...the dog itself I didn't find to be any better than grabbing a dog here. The chili sauce had a great flavor but it wasn't super meaty. Dogs were cooked well and the rolls were fresh. All in all I would say that these are definitely something to stop in for when in the area. Better or worse than Rutt's or Hot Grill? I don't know, I enjoyed them all honestly. I usually visit before 12pm but they serve breakfast all day long. Plenty of space for a large family or just two people. The staff is friendly and two of the waitresses were originally from the Getty grill - if anyone remembers that spot before they shut down. The wait wasn't long and once we ordered we received our order immediately, within minutes. The waitresses are courteous, humorous and friendly. The pancakes were fluffy, home fries were just right and the toast wasn't over done. No complaints here. Overall we had a nice time and we never felt rushed, even after eating, we had brief conversation. Definitely a good spot any day of the week...bon appetite
